WebThe most extensively investigated temperature/pH sensitive systems are based on poly (N-isopropylacrylamide) (PNIPAM). A series of temperature- and pH-sensitive polymers based on poly (N-isopropylacrylamide) has been developed. PNIPAM can be chain-end functionalized with carboxylic acid, NHS ester, amine, and maleimide groups. Web19 Sep 2024 · Manufacturers of vaccines and other pharmaceuticals rely on quality cold chain logistics to get their products safely from door to door. Vaccines that require temperature-controlled shipping must be kept between (2℃–8℃) or -20°C in order to maintain the effectiveness of their active ingredients. Losing their efficacy means wasting ...
